#142cce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#142cce is composed of 7.8% red, 17.3%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.3% cyan, 78.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 232.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 44.3%. #142cce color hex could be obtained by blending #2858ff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#142cce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010209 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#142cce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6c77 is the less saturated color, while #031fdf is the most saturated one.
